Men's Soccer Wins 2-1 in OT at Coker; Clinch Fourth Seed in SAC Tournament

HARTSVILLE, S.C. – The Anderson University men's soccer team picked up a big 2-1 win on Wednesday (Nov. 3) against the Coker University Cobras in a thrilling overtime victory.

Tonight's game had big implications on the upcoming South Atlantic Conference tournament, with both the Cobras and Trojans fighting to clinch a postseason berth. It was the Cobras who came out and controlled the first half of play, scoring late in the 41st minute to take a 1-0 lead into halftime.

However, Anderson was able to flip the script in the second half. The Trojans outshot the Cobras 10 to five, with the equalizing goal coming in the 63rd minute when Eloy Allimadi connected with Santiago Arce Alvarez on a header. Perhaps the moment of the match came with less than 30 seconds remaining in regulation, when top goal scorer for Coker Jacques Fokam-Sandeu broke past the Trojan defense for a one on one scoring opportunity, but goalkeeper Gal Elyashiv was there for a big diving save to keep the score at 1-1 going into overtime.

Anderson carried that momentum into the first overtime period. In the 97th minute, Alexandre Cox-Ashwood found some space in the attacking third, and played a beautiful ball to Eloy Allmadi for the match-clinching goal.

With the win, the Trojans clinched the fourth seed in the SAC tournament, giving them the opportunity to host a quarterfinal match against Queens on Saturday. Before tonight's match, Anderson was ranked ninth in the latest NCAA Super Region 2 rankings. For the SAC, Limestone was fifth and Lenoir-Rhyne tabbed ninth.

"Great win for the boys and our program tonight against a top team," said coach Michael Zion. "The effort they put into the game to fight back from being a goal down and then push on to win it was incredible. We will look to keep this momentum going into quarterfinals."
